草果在实时渲染引擎中的高效运用,如何平衡性能与视觉效果?

在实时渲染引擎的广阔世界里,草果——这一自然界的元素,不仅是游戏场景真实感的关键,也是对性能优化提出挑战的典型案例,草果的密集生长与复杂的光照交互,要求引擎在保证视觉效果的同时,还需兼顾流畅的帧率和低系统负荷。

问题: 在实时渲染中,如何精确模拟草果的细节,同时避免因过多细节导致的性能瓶颈?

回答: 草果的模拟涉及两个核心方面:一是草的物理模拟,包括风的影响、生长行为等;二是视觉效果的渲染,如叶子的透明度、光照反射等,为了平衡这两者,我们可以采用以下策略:

1、LOD(Level of Detail)技术:根据草果与视点的距离动态调整其细节级别,近处时展现高细节,远处则使用低多边形模型以减少计算量。

2、粒子系统与群体智能:利用粒子系统模拟草的动态行为,如随风摇曳,通过群体智能算法优化草的交互,减少单个草的独立计算,提高整体效率。

3、光照与阴影优化:采用延迟光照(Deferred Shading)技术,先计算光照再处理渲染,减少每帧的运算量,利用阴影贴图或阴影映射技术减少不必要的阴影计算,特别是在草丛密集区域。

4、纹理与材质优化:使用纹理压缩技术减少内存占用,同时采用基于屏幕空间的细节增强(SSAO)等技术,在保持视觉效果的同时降低资源消耗。

草果在实时渲染引擎中的高效运用,如何平衡性能与视觉效果?

通过上述策略的综合运用,我们可以在实时渲染引擎中实现既真实又高效的草果模拟,既保证了游戏的视觉冲击力,又确保了流畅的游戏体验,这不仅是技术上的挑战,更是对艺术与科学完美结合的探索。

相关阅读

发表评论

  • 匿名用户  发表于 2025-02-20 04:34 回复

    在实时渲染引擎中,草果的高效运用需巧妙平衡算法优化与视觉细节呈现以提升性能同时保证逼真效果。

  • 匿名用户  发表于 2025-04-24 00:46 回复

    草果在实时渲染引擎中,通过智能优化算法平衡性能与视觉效果之争。

添加新评论